Output 7fbcf6ddbb9269904f034805e177e3aefdee1f66e3aa05ab14fbf0b7627dfe1d:1

value
526722
script pubkey
OP_0 OP_PUSHBYTES_20 529390a6fd9cbc2dccf72b46080195173ad9b10f
address
bc1q22fepfhanj7zmn8h9drqsqv4zuadnvg02kqp4n
transaction
7fbcf6ddbb9269904f034805e177e3aefdee1f66e3aa05ab14fbf0b7627dfe1d
confirmations
197006
spent
true